Determining Your Lodging Requirements

When thinking about a hotel stay, how can one effectively assess their accommodation needs? First, it is vital to recognize the purpose of the trip. Whether for business, leisure, or a special occasion, each scenario requires specific requirements. For instance, business travelers might give priority to proximity to meeting venues and reliable internet access, while families may seek additional space and child-friendly amenities.

Subsequently, budget constraints play a significant role. Defining a price range helps narrow down options without overspending. Additionally, the number of occupants influences the choice as well; a solo traveler might prefer a compact room, while a group may call for multiple beds or adjoining rooms.

In conclusion, personal preferences should not be overlooked. Some guests could desire unique features including a balcony, a particular bed type, or pet-friendly accommodations. By thoroughly weighing these aspects, one can ensure a much more satisfying hotel experience adapted to their specific needs.

Assessing Hotel Facilities

While organizing a hotel stay, reviewing amenities is essential for ensuring a relaxing and pleasant experience. Individual travelers have diverse preferences, making it crucial to identify which amenities match individual needs. Frequently available features include complimentary breakfast, Wi-Fi access, fitness centers, and swimming pools. A well-equipped business center can also benefit corporate travelers, while families may prioritize kids' clubs comprehensive resource or babysitting services.

Furthermore, in-room features including mini-fridges, coffee makers, and roomy bathrooms can substantially boost the general comfort. Certain hotels may provide distinctive features such as rooftop lounges or spa services, enhancing the allure of the stay.

Guests ought to also assess the quality of services, as inadequately kept facilities can undermine the experience. By meticulously examining these features, travelers can identify accommodations that not only fulfill their basic requirements but also improve their entire hotel experience.

Your Location Matters: Selecting the Perfect Area

Where a hotel is situated plays an essential role in forming the guest experience. Proximity to key attractions, business districts, or natural landscapes can greatly influence a traveler's choice. Visitors typically look for accessibility, which could mean being close to renowned dining establishments, historical sites, or transit stations. A thoughtfully positioned hotel not only increases ease of access but also enhances the complete experience by connecting visitors with the local atmosphere.

In addition, the neighborhood's safety and ambiance boost the appeal. Quiet, charming areas can attract leisure travelers, while energetic, bustling districts could cater to those seeking nightlife and entertainment.

Finally, savvy travelers will evaluate these factors thoroughly, making certain their preferred hotel aligns with their personal preferences and desired activities. By choosing a strategically located hotel, guests can increase their pleasure and convenience, paving the way for a more memorable and enjoyable travel experience.

Exploring Customer Reviews and Recommendations

Before settling on a hotel choice, countless travelers refer to reviews and recommendations as a valuable resource. These insights give a glimpse into the experiences of earlier visitors, emphasizing both the strengths and weaknesses of a property. Digital platforms, such as travel websites and social media, deliver a plethora of opinions that can affect decisions.

Travelers commonly search for consistent themes in reviews, such as hygiene, quality of service, and the accuracy of hotel descriptions. Suggestions from family or friends can also hold considerable weight, as individual experiences are typically regarded as more dependable.

Critical comments can act as a red flag, prompting potential guests to reevaluate their options. Nevertheless, it is crucial to assess the overall sentiment rather than focus on individual reviews. By meticulously evaluating these perspectives, travelers can make educated selections that correspond to their tastes and expectations, ultimately improving their accommodation experience.

Can Pets Stay in All Hotels?

Hotels don't universally permit pets. Policies vary widely, with particular hotels embracing pets while others implement strict pet prohibitions. It is important for travelers to check individual hotel policies before making a reservation.

What Is the Mechanism Behind Hotel Loyalty Programs?

Frequent guests earn points through hotel loyalty programs for their stays, that can be exchanged for free accommodations, upgrades, or premium benefits. Participants benefit from discounted rates, priority access during check-in, and tailored services at member properties.

When Are Check-In and Check-Out?

Check-in times generally range from 3 PM to 4 PM, while check-out typically takes place between 11 AM and noon. These times can differ depending on the hotel, so we recommend confirming specific policies directly with the property.
